Transaction 8abbf28f4cc131603a7ca4d4935c17f8b85a1772d9e19fc9b09233999bfa2928
1 Input
1 Output
-
8abbf28f4cc131603a7ca4d4935c17f8b85a1772d9e19fc9b09233999bfa2928:0
- value
- 3850241
- script pubkey
- OP_0 OP_PUSHBYTES_20 170916b546687d165af732e35dccba29e2f6b86e
- address
- bc1qzuy3dd2xdp73vkhhxt34mn969830dwrw56qkw2